The Baader Planetarium fhalhs-2 HighSpeed Narrowband CCD Filter is a premium astronomical accessory designed for advanced astrophotographers. This filter is specifically engineered for imaging hydrogen-alpha emission lines, making it an excellent choice for capturing the stunning details of nebulae, star-forming regions, and other celestial objects rich in hydrogen.
The fhalhs-2 HighSpeed filter features a narrowband optical design with a central wavelength of 656.3 nm and a bandwidth of only 10 nm. This narrow bandwidth is crucial for minimizing light pollution and stray light, ensuring that the captured images are as pure and detailed as possible. The filter is made from high-quality Schott glass, which is coated with Baader's proprietary Multi-Coatings to reduce reflections and increase transmission efficiency.
The filter has a thread size of 2" and is designed to fit most CCD cameras with a 2" filter thread. It is also available in other sizes, including 1.25", to accommodate a wider range of telescopes and imaging systems. The filter is constructed with a durable aluminum frame and includes a dust cap for protection during storage and transportation.

The Baader Planetarium FHALHS-2 HighSpeed Narrowband CCD Filter Alpha is a specialized optical filter designed for astrophotography, particularly for capturing details in nebulae and other deep-sky objects. Here are some pros and cons to consider before making a purchase:
Pros:1. High Transmission: The FHALHS-2 filter has high transmission in the H-alpha wavelength, allowing more light to pass through and resulting in brighter and more detailed images.
2. Narrowband: The filter only allows specific wavelengths of light to pass, reducing the amount of light pollution and atmospheric interference, leading to clearer images.
3. Quality Construction: Baader Planetarium is known for its high-quality optical filters, and the FHALHS-2 is no exception. It is made from Schott glass and has multiple coatings for optimal performance.
4. Versatility: The filter can be used with a variety of CCD and DSLR cameras and telescopes.
Cons:1. Expensive: The FHALHS-2 filter is quite pricey, making it a significant investment for hobbyist or beginner astronomers.
2. Requires Specific Equipment: To use this filter, you'll need a telescope with a specific type of focal reducer and a camera that is compatible with narrowband filters.
3. Learning Curve: Capturing images with a narrowband filter requires a good understanding of astrophotography techniques, image processing software, and calibration procedures.
